Nine years later, I bought an Afghan puppy of my own. Pictured left: Tempany, Molriq Unchanied Melody. A lovely Brindle puppy, out of Mr John Mort's, Molriq Calypso. I was encouraged by John and Claire, to Show Tempany at the local open show at Deeside, where she achieved a second place win, first time out. I continued Showing her, moving on to Championship level, where she qualified for Crufts at Manchester, handled by (Mrs Pat Latimer), owner of Tempany's sire, Champion Zharook Hooked On Love. Much to my delight, we were also introduced to the joys of Afghan Racing, currently held at the Thornton Road Stadium in Ellesmere Port on the first Sunday of every month, from March through to November. I throughly reccommend that you make a visit to see the fun for yourself...! Pictured Right: Tempany and Amenti awaiting the next race. Although our two girls are not very speedy, they absolutely love racing and make the most of being allowed off the lead to run freely, in safety.

In 1999 I applied for the Hakmet Affix (Kennel Name), as I had decided to breed from
Tempany and she was subsequently mated to Chris Amoo's, Champion Sade Beryk. She had a litter of 12 pups but only nine survived. Pictured Right: Tempany With Nine Beautiful Puppies. The little bitch we kept we named Amenti, (Egyptian Meaning: Goddess With Long Flowing Blonde Hair). Pictured Below Left: Hakmet Aton Aspect Of The Sun. Amenti also qualified for Crufts at her first show, following my absence from the Show Ring for a few years; this time handled by Mrs Claire Kirk. Pictured Below Right: Amenti, at Breed Show in Manchester handled by myself. My husband Taff and I made the big decision to have a further litter of puppies with Amenti in 2004,
but her coming into season coincided with a long awaited trip to Australia. So the mating with Claire Kirks Istani Against All Odds JW, was postponed to February 2005. New Years eve of 2004 brought the devastating news that Amenti's mum Tempany, was diagnosed with a Squamous Cell Carcinoma (a tumour in the nose). Since
then she has received a course of Radio Therapy treatment at Cambridge University Veterinary School, which has gained her a slightly longer life
expectancy but unhappily not a cure. This dreadful news made us even more determined, that on the dawning of her next season, Amenti's planned mating to the lovely Yaris, Istani Against All Odds (owned by Claire Kirk) should definitely go ahead. The temperament and Show quality from Tempany's line of breeding was much too good to lose. Pictured Right: Yaris, Istani Against All Odds. Pictured Left: A very heavilly pregnant Amenti, full of pups with only a few more days to go. Our lady in waiting in her most comfortable position. Happily on the 9th April 2005, we
were blessed with the arrival of eight very healthy puppies, with a fairly straight forward labour. What a fantastic Mum Amenti has since proved to be. Pictured Left: Amenti's first born, Ashraf. Aproximately ten minutes old. He was a very big pup and was stuck in the birth canal for some time, holding up the delivery of his litter brothers and sisters. This is the order in which they were all born. Ashraf, Remmy, Savannah, Kabul, Lydia, the second, Rory, Ayesha and Lydia. Pictured Right: A very proud Mum with her new arrivals. Four dogs and four bitches, a lovely even litter. Once the puppies are six months of age, it is our intention to Show the three babies who are to remain with us, Ayesha, Hakmet Black Gold Texas Tea. Show Time:
I am delighted to say that our two male puppies, Ashraf and Kabul have started out well in their show careers. At present Ashraf, Hakmet Golden Pharaoh heads the leader board having gained a V.H.C at the Birmingham Afghan Hound Club Championship Show, (handled by Claire Kirk) back in November 2005 under Judge, Mrs C Humphries (Knossos). Then going on to win Best Puppy In Show at the Yorkshire Afghan Society Open Show (handled by Claire Kirk) in January 2006, under Judge Mrs Pauline Gibbs (Montravia). Pictured Above Left: Claire handling Ashraf, Judge Mrs Pauline Gibbs. John Mort handling Lydia, Hakmet Band Of Gold, (Kabul and Ash's litter sister...), also (Reserve Best Puppy) and myself (for photo only) with Pinto, Istani Truly Madly Deeply, one of Claire's own puppies. Going on to win the Reserve Best Puppy In Show title, at the Northern Afghan
Hound Society Championship Show (Also handled by Claire Kirk) in March 2006. Pictured Right: The Northern Afghan Hound Society Championship Show: Claire Kirk handling Ashraf, with Show Judges Mr T. Jepson and Mrs Audrey Bell. Kabul, Hakmet Clogau Welsh Gold also competed in the same class at this show, (handled by myself) and gained second place behind his brother Ashraf. Pictured Left: Kabul second behind brother Ashraf.
Both puppies have now qualified for Crufts 2007.

CRUFTS 2007
We had a wonderful time. After a lot of preparation and frazzled nerves, leading up to the big day, Kabul and I won our first card, in the biggest and best dog show in the world. Kabul gained a 3rd in Yearling Dog, under Judge: Mrs D Waterman. Alas, Ashraf did not make the final cut in Under Graduate Dog but he enjoyed himself nonetheless. Over in the Bitches Ring, Lydia, the boys litter sister, gained a V.H.C (Very Highly Commended) in Graduate Bitch, Under Judge Mrs P. A Latimer. Needless to say I am very proud of both dogs.
